ZIP Code 96770 (Maui County, Hawaii) is home to about 548 residents. Its median household income of $56,591 runs below the Maui County figure of $95,076.
From 2019 to 2023, ZIP Code 96770's population declined 12.2% from 624 to 548, while its median gross rent rose 48.6% from $757 to $1,125.
The typical home was built around 1979. 19.7% of residents live below the poverty line.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 624 | $29,167 | $392,300 | $757 |
| 2020 | 493 | $33,125 | $275,000 | $684 |
| 2021 | 435 | $44,318 | $248,400 | $807 |
| 2022 | 465 | $52,656 | $243,900 | $971 |
| 2023 | 548 | $56,591 | $362,300 | $1,125 |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
